Completion Date
In the conveyancing process, completion date is the day that the seller moves out and the new owner moves in.
Technically, this is the day that:
- the buyers solicitor sends the remaining funds to the seller’s solicitor.
- the seller’s solicitor sends the signed transfer deed and an undertaking to discharge any outstanding mortgage to the buyers solicitor
- the estate agent receives their commission from the seller’s solicitor
- the seller’s solicitor clears the outstanding mortgage if there is one
- the remainder of the sale proceeds are transferred to the seller, or up the chain if applicable
- a completion statement is sent to the buyer
- both the buyer and seller’s solicitor get paid
- the estate agent is told to release the keys
